diff options
author | Bruno Haible <bruno@clisp.org> | 2017-05-10 19:19:51 +0200 |
---|---|---|
committer | Bruno Haible <bruno@clisp.org> | 2017-05-10 19:19:51 +0200 |
commit | 67d14683778cb3fd8dbfda5a03f5fe407f57389a (patch) | |
tree | 19fc3d2bf61f2514a25a47aee028b0402986004b /doc/obsolete.texi | |
parent | 3f67783fb1ff94c6a3732cfbc4850048bcabc4ff (diff) | |
download | gnulib-67d14683778cb3fd8dbfda5a03f5fe407f57389a.tar.gz |
Prepare for reordering sections in the manual.
* doc/gnulib.texi: Move several sections to separate files. Include
these files.
* doc/out-of-memory.texi: New file, extracted from doc/gnulib.texi.
* doc/obsolete.texi: Likewise.
* doc/extra-tests.texi: Likewise.
* doc/transversal.texi: Likewise.
* doc/namespace.texi: Likewise.
* doc/check-version.texi: Likewise.
* doc/windows-sockets.texi: Likewise.
* doc/windows-libtool.texi: Likewise.
* doc/licenses-texi.texi: Likewise.
* doc/build-automation.texi: Likewise.
* doc/c-locale.texi: Likewise.
Diffstat (limited to 'doc/obsolete.texi')
-rw-r--r-- | doc/obsolete.texi | 23 |
1 files changed, 23 insertions, 0 deletions
diff --git a/doc/obsolete.texi b/doc/obsolete.texi new file mode 100644 index 0000000000..90280ce392 --- /dev/null +++ b/doc/obsolete.texi @@ -0,0 +1,23 @@ +@node Obsolete modules +@section Obsolete modules + +@cindex Obsolete modules +Modules can be marked obsolete. This means that the problems they fix +don't occur any more on the platforms that are reasonable porting targets +now. @code{gnulib-tool} warns when obsolete modules are mentioned on the +command line, and by default ignores dependencies from modules to obsolete +modules. When you pass the option @code{--with-obsolete} to +@code{gnulib-tool}, dependencies to obsolete modules will be included, +however, unless blocked through an @code{--avoid} option. This option +is useful if your package should be portable even to very old platforms. + +In order to mark a module obsolete, you need to add this to the module +description: + +@example +Status: +obsolete + +Notice: +This module is obsolete. +@end example |